    Effective Communication After a Breakup

    image

    Effective communication is a cornerstone in the "breakup 2 makeup" process. It involves expressing thoughts and feelings honestly, while also being receptive to the other person's perspective. Post-breakup, this can be challenging due to lingering emotions, but it's essential for understanding and resolving underlying issues.

    One key aspect is active listening. This means truly hearing and trying to understand what the other person is saying, without immediately jumping to conclusions or becoming defensive. It's about creating a safe space where both parties feel heard and respected.

    Using "I" statements is a helpful communication tool. Rather than placing blame, it's about expressing one's own feelings and experiences. For example, saying "I feel hurt when..." instead of "You hurt me by..." can reduce defensiveness and promote understanding.

    Timing and setting also play a critical role in effective communication. Choosing a calm, neutral environment and a suitable time for both parties ensures that the conversation is productive and free from unnecessary distractions or tensions.

    Empathy is crucial. Trying to understand the other person's feelings and viewpoint can foster compassion and healing. It's not just about agreeing but acknowledging each other's emotions and experiences.

    Lastly, it's important to know when to seek external help, like counseling or mediation. Sometimes, an impartial third party can facilitate better communication, helping to bridge gaps and resolve misunderstandings.

    Rebuilding Trust in a Relationship

    Trust is the foundation of any relationship, and rebuilding it after a breakup is a delicate process. It requires time, patience, and consistent effort from both partners. The "breakup 2 makeup" journey often hinges on this crucial aspect.

    Transparency is key in rebuilding trust. It involves open and honest communication about feelings, actions, and intentions. Both partners need to feel secure in sharing their thoughts without fear of judgment or retaliation.

    Consistency in actions and words is vital. Trust is built through small, consistent actions that show reliability and commitment. It's about aligning actions with promises, showing that one is dependable and true to their word.

    Understanding and forgiving past mistakes is another crucial step. While forgiveness does not mean forgetting or excusing hurtful behavior, it's about moving past it constructively and not holding it over each other's heads.

    Setting new boundaries and expectations can help prevent future issues. This involves a mutual understanding of what is acceptable and what is not, creating a safe and respectful environment for both partners.

    Finally, patience cannot be overstated. Rebuilding trust doesn't happen overnight. It's a journey that requires understanding, compassion, and time to heal and grow stronger together.

    Setting Healthy Boundaries

    image

    In the "breakup 2 makeup" journey, setting healthy boundaries is crucial for a balanced and respectful relationship. Boundaries help define what is acceptable and what is not, ensuring mutual respect and understanding.

    Identifying personal limits is the first step in setting boundaries. This involves understanding one's own needs, values, and comfort levels in various aspects of the relationship.

    Communicating these boundaries clearly and respectfully to the partner is essential. It's about expressing one's needs in a way that is assertive but not aggressive, ensuring the other person understands and respects these limits.

    Boundaries can be emotional, such as needing space to process feelings, or physical, like respecting personal space. They also include boundaries around time, energy, and other resources.

    It's important to be consistent in maintaining these boundaries. This consistency helps reinforce the importance of these limits and ensures that they are respected over time.

    Respecting the partner's boundaries is just as important. It's about acknowledging and honoring their limits, which fosters mutual respect and understanding in the relationship.

    Finally, it's essential to be flexible and open to renegotiating boundaries. As individuals and relationships grow, needs and limits can change, requiring adjustments to these boundaries.

    When to Seek Professional Help

    During the "breakup 2 makeup" process, there may come a time when seeking professional help is beneficial. Recognizing when this step is necessary can be crucial for the health of the relationship.

    One key indicator is persistent communication issues. If discussions frequently lead to arguments or misunderstandings, a therapist can provide tools and strategies to improve communication.

    If there are unresolved issues, such as trust breaches or deep-seated resentments, professional guidance can be invaluable in addressing these complex emotions and facilitating healing.

    When individual mental health concerns, such as depression or anxiety, affect the relationship, it's important to seek help. Addressing these issues can improve not only personal well-being but also the dynamics of the relationship.

    Lastly, if there's a desire to improve the relationship but uncertainty about how to do so, a professional can offer objective insights and advice to help the couple navigate their unique challenges.
